SIGN Tokenomics FAQ – Key Questions About Sign

What is the token allocation for SIGN?

Sign token distribution allocates 10,000,000,000 SIGN across 4 primary stakeholder groups:

  • Community: 50.00% (Community Rewards 30.00%, Ecosystem 10.00%, TGE Airdrop 10.00%)
  • Foundation: 20.00% (Foundation 20.00%)
  • Investors: 20.00% (Backers 20.00%)
  • Insiders: 10.00% (Early Team Members 10.00%)

What is the vesting schedule for SIGN?

SIGN uses variable cliffs and vesting schedules that change depending on the allocation:

  • Community Rewards: 3 Month Cliff, 60 Month Linear Vesting
  • Foundation: 5.0% at TGE , Linear Vesting Every 3 Months x20
  • Backers: 12 Month Cliff, 24 Month Linear Vesting
  • Ecosystem: 10.0% at TGE , Linear Vesting Every 3 Months x20
  • Early Team Members: 12 Month Cliff, 36 Month Linear Vesting
  • TGE Airdrop: 100.0% at TGE

How many SIGN tokens unlock at TGE?

12% of the total supply (1,200,000,000 SIGN) is unlocked at TGE, with the tokens split between Community and Foundation.

What is the total supply and circulating supply of SIGN?

Sign has a total supply of 10,000,000,000 SIGN, of which 1,630,000,000 SIGN (16.3% of total) is currently circulating.

What is the token emission schedule for SIGN?

Total length of the full Sign emission schedule is 6 years, with 21.60% released in Year 1, while the remaining 78.40% is released over the following 5 years.

What are the investor terms for SIGN private and seed rounds?

Sign has 1 investor round, with the following investment price and vesting:

  • Backers: priced at $0.014, with 12 Month Cliff, 24 Month Linear Vesting

What percentage of SIGN is allocated to the community?

50% of the Sign supply is allocated to community focused pools such as Community Rewards, Ecosystem, and TGE Airdrop.

What is Sign (SIGN)?

$SIGN is the utility token that powers the Sign blockchain, a cutting-edge platform designed to revolutionize secure global communication and ensure data privacy through decentralized technology. At its essence, Sign is focused on building a privacy-first ecosystem, enabling seamless collaboration, secure messaging, and confidential data exchange for individuals and enterprises worldwide. The $SIGN token serves multiple critical utilities within the ecosystem. It facilitates transaction fees, enables staking for network participation, governs protocol decisions through voting rights, and rewards users contributing to the platform's security and development. By participating in staking, holders not only secure the network but also earn rewards, reinforcing the blockchain's decentralization and security. Underpinning the $SIGN tokenomics model is a robust, transparent economic architecture. The token supply is capped, maintaining scarcity and long-term value. Allocations are strategically distributed among ecosystem development, community incentives, liquidity provisioning, and developer rewards. The deflationary mechanisms, combined with active utility, contribute to a balanced and sustainable model that supports network growth and ecosystem enhancement. The technical advantages of the Sign platform include end-to-end encryption, decentralized identity protocols, and tamper-proof blockchain infrastructure. These features provide value to industries such as healthcare, finance, and legal sectors, where data confidentiality and security are paramount. Enterprises seeking reliable and scalable communication solutions turn to Sign for trusted decentralized systems. $SIGN lies at the heart of this transformative platform, empowering users to take ownership of their data while enabling secure, immutable communication. Designed for scalability and privacy-conscious users, Sign firmly positions itself as a leader in the blockchain communication space.
